E-cadherin focuses protrusion formation at the front of migrating cells by impeding actin flow

The migration of many cell types relies on the formation of actomyosin-dependent protrusions called blebs, but the mechanisms responsible for focusing this kind of protrusive activity to the cell front are largely unknown.
